hi! i have a 125g. mixed reef tank. my current parameters are as follows; sal.-1.025, phos.-.22, alk.-7.6, nitrate-13.9, cal. 453, ph 7.9. i have been thinking of starting all for reef. is that a good idea or no? i currently do not dose anything. TIA!

The numbers you posted are just that, a number. You will need to understand your displays consumption rate over time. Then you can determine if you need to add anything additional.

It could be that your water change schedule is enough. It may not be. Test a couple times a week, at the same time of day, pulling water from the same general area, and plot those numbers out.
